History Embedded From Esso to Engro 1


1957-1966

In 1957, the search for oil by Pak Stanvac, an Esso/Mobil joint venture led to the discovery of
the Mari Gas field near Daharki, which is the rural village in upper Sindh. Esso proposed the establishment of a urea plant in that area which led to a fertilizer plant agreement signed in 1964. In the succeeding year, Esso Pakistan Fertilizer Company Limited was incorporated, with 75% of the shares owned by Esso and 25% by the general public. The Production of urea plant in Daharki started in 1968, after the proper establishment is 1966, at US $43 million with an annual production capacity of 173,000 tons; it was the single largest foreign investment by a multinational corporation in Pakistan at the time. A full-fledged marketing organization was established which undertook agronomic programs to educate the farmers of Pakistan. As the nations first fertilizer brand, Engro (then Esso) helped update traditional farming practices to enhance farm yields, directly impacting the quality of life not only for farmers and their families, but for the nation at large. As a result of these efforts, consumption of fertilizers increased in Pakistan, paving the way for the Companys branded urea called Engro, an acronym for Energy for Growth.

1966-1991

As part of an international name change program, Esso became Exxon in 1978 and the
Company was renamed Exxon Chemical Pakistan Limited. The Company continued to prosper as it relentlessly pursued productivity gains and strived to attain professional excellence. In 1991, Exxon decided to divest its fertilizer business on a global basis. The employees of Exxon Chemical Pakistan Limited, in partnership with leading international and local financial institutions, bought out Exxons 75% equity. This was at the time and perhaps still is the most successful employee buy-out in the corporate history of Pakistan. Renamed as Engro Chemical Pakistan Limited, the Company has gone from strength to strength, reflected in its consistent financial performance, growth of the core fertilizer business, and diversification into other businesses. Engro Chemical Pakistan Limited then started a journey of venturing into other sectors including foods, energy, industrial control and automation, PVC resin manufacturing and marketing, and chemical terminal and storage. 2000 onwards

In 2009 plans were announced of demerging the fertilizer business into an independent
operating company. The expansion and growth in the company necessitated a change in the way the company operated and conducted business. Keeping in view the operations of multi category businesses, expansion strategy and growth vision, the management decided that the various businesses would be better served if the Company was converted to a holding company. As a result it was decided to demerge the fertilizer business and establish a holding company structure to manage the affairs of various businesses. To reflect the change in the scope of mandate and scale of operations, Engro Chemical Pakistan Limited has been renamed as Engro Corporation Limited with effect from January 1, 2010. Engro Corp, as the holding company is responsible for the long term vision of the company, overseeing the performance of the subsidiaries and affiliates, allocation of capital, management

of talent, leadership development, HR guiding policies, leadership role in public relations and CSR activities, control structures, legal and IT support. Engro Corp will maintain a lean structure with a focused scope, allowing maximum empowerment to the subsidiaries and affiliates to drive the operations of their respective organizations.

Engro Foods Engro Foods Limited was officially launched as a fully owned subsidiary of Engro in 2004. Using dairy as a stepping stone to enter into the food business, the Company has established high-tech processing units in Sukkur and Sahiwal, along with an ice cream production facility in Sahiwal. Top quality brands like Olpers, Olwell, Tarang, Omore and Owsum have been successfully launched under the wheel of Companys dairy products. To support these brands and their highest standards of quality, Engro Foods has invested heavily in milk processing and milk collection infrastructure. With an acquisition of Al Safa . a fast growing and established

Halal meat brand . Engro Foods is now venturing into North American market starting from Halal Foods category. The new organization, Engro Foods Canada Ltd. with a subsidiary Engro Foods USA, LLC, intends to aggressively grow the business in this market. With the vision of Elevating Consumer Delight Worldwide, Companys significant focus will be towards the global operations in the years to come. Engro Fertilizers Engro Fertilizers Limited is a wholly owned subsidiary of Engro Corporation and a renowned name in Pakistans fertilizer industry. Engro Fertilizers holds a vast, nationwide production and marketing infrastructure and produces leading fertilizer brands optimized for local cultivation needs and demand. Engro Fertilizers is also a leading importer and seller of Phosphate products, which are marketed extensively across Pakistan as phosphate fertilizers. Their extensive market development activities have ensured a sustained pull for their primary and secondary fertilizer products and sellout productions since launch. Engro Fertilizers Limited was incorporated in June 2009, following a decision to demerge fertilizer concern from its parent company Engro Chemical Pakistan Limited. The continual expansions and diversifications in its enterprises necessitated a broad restructuring in Engro Chemical operations and management. To facilitate better oversight, Engro Chemical Pakistan was converted into a holding company named Engro Corporation, and its fertilizer business was subsequently demerged to a newly formed Engro subsidiary that was Engro Fertilizers Limited. Engro Fertilizers is poised to become the leading urea manufacturer in the country following major upgrading of its manufacturing capabilities. Engro Polymers and Chemicals Engro Polymer & Chemicals Limited, an Engro subsidiary, is Pakistans leading manufacturer and marketer of PVC (polyvinyl chloride) resin, with an annual PVC production of 150,000 tons. The Company markets its products under the brand name of SABZ. Following

recent expansion, the Company now has an integrated facility with the capability to manufacture EDC, VCM, Chlorine and Caustic soda. The Company is the sole producer of PVC resin, hence plays a pivotal role in ensuring the sustainability of the domestic PVC industry and provides support through the provision of quality products and technical services. It also invests in developing new products and markets; as part of market development it is looking to set up a complete business line for the construction industry by promoting PVC based doors and windows. Engro Polymer & Chemicals Limited has been consecutive winners of ACCA-WWF Environment Reporting awards for its environment performance reports; consequently, the Company was nominated to be on the panel of judges for the award. Engro Polymer & Chemicals Limited won the Annual Environment Excellence Award from National Forum for Environment and Health for the fourth time in 2009.
